About This Item

New York: Farrar, Straus and Giroux, 1967. Hardcover. Fine/Near Fine. First American edition. Translated from the German by Michael Hamburger, Christopher Holme, Ruth and Matthew Mead, and Michael Roloff. Contains both the original German and English translation of the poems but only the English translation of the play, *Eli*. Owner bookplate on the front pastedown, else fine in a near fine dust jacket with a small nick on the front panel, very light edgewear, and some rubbing. The bookplate is that of American bassoonist, Sol Schoenbach featuring what appears to be an illustration of a well-dressed monkey playing a bassoon. An award winning musician, Schoenbach was the principle bassoonist for the Philadelphia Orchestra from 1937 to 1957.

About Between the Covers- Rare Books, Inc. ABAA

Between the Covers-Rare Books, Inc., founded in 1985, specializes in first editions of 20th Century American and English fiction. Our inventory of over 75,000 first editions includes: African-American literature & history, Mysteries, Detective Fiction, Drama, Books into Film and Sports books. We routinely issue extensively illustrated color catalogs, available by subscription. We are members of the Antiquarian Booksellers' Association of America (ABAA)and the International League of Antiquarian Booksellers (ILAB). Tom Congalton, founder of Between the Covers-Rare Books, Inc., actively promotes the ethics and standards of these professional organizations and served as President of the ABAA from 2000 to 2002.
